
Acier vs Gray Shingle
Both are Sherwin-Williams colors. Both sit in the grey family, which is useful context if you're narrowing within a single hue direction. At LRV 32 vs 29, Acier will read as the brighter of the two — a 3-point gap that matters most in north-facing or low-light rooms. They share a neutral quality — useful to know if you're layering them in the same space. At ΔE 4.8, the difference is perceptible but not dramatic — the two can work harmoniously in the same space.
